Top Finance Apps on Android in Europe Q4 2021
Explore the performance trends of the top 5 finance apps on the Android platform in Europe during Q4 2021. Track weekly downloads, revenue, and active user metrics to see how these apps fared.
In the fourth quarter of 2021, the top five finance apps on the Android platform in Europe showed varying trends in downloads, revenue, and active users.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, provides a detailed look at these performance metrics.
TradingView: Track All Markets exhibited significant growth in we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$213K in late November. Weekly downloads for the app increased steadily, reaching around 40K by the end of November. Active users also saw a rise, starting at 406K in late September and peaking at 560K by the end of November.
QBSE maintained a relatively stable weekly revenue, hovering between $10K and $17K throughout the quarter. Weekly downloads fluctuated slightly, peaking at 1.3K in late November. Active users showed a slight decline from 14K in late September to around 11.8K by the end of December.
WISO Steuer – Tax Declaration saw a notable increase in weekly revenue, reaching approximately $38K in late October before stabilizing around $7K-$8K towards the end of the year. Weekly downloads peaked at 10K in late October, while active users saw a rise from 13.5K in late September to 17.2K by the end of October, before settling around 15.6K by the end of December.
Investing.com: Stock Market experienced a steady increase in weekly revenue, peaking at about $26.5K in late November. Weekly downloads were strong, consistently above 70K, with a peak of 100K in late October. Active users saw a consistent rise from 1.07M in late September to 1.27M by the end of November.
Finanzguru - Konten & Verträge showed stable weekly revenue, ranging between $7K and $9K throughout the quarter. Weekly downloads fluctuated, peaking at 12.3K in late December. Active users remained relatively stable, starting at 92.5K in late September and peaking at 109.6K by the end of December.
